using System; public class Hello { static void Main() { var n = long.Parse(Console.ReadLine().Trim()); var k = long.Parse(Console.ReadLine().Trim()); getAns(n, k); } static long calc(long n, long a) { if (a > 2 * n + 1) return 0; if (a <= n) return a - 1; return 2 * n - a + 1; } static void getAns(long n, long k) { var ans = 0L; for (long i = 2; i * i <= k; i++) { if (k % i == 0) { var te = calc(n, i); if (k / i != i) ans += te * calc(n, k / i) * 2; else ans += te * te; } } Console.WriteLine(ans); } }